Output 06520efad83d021ca05f39038532ae2b5f049c5720cfd52717accf41ec7023f9:1

value
17935786
script pubkey
OP_0 OP_PUSHBYTES_32 538b6da83f44bce744bc8327caea4ac680571fa1653097ce0233646be36239c2
address
bc1q2w9km2plgj7ww39usvnu46j2c6q9w8apv5cf0nszxdjxhcmz88pqz6ft27
transaction
06520efad83d021ca05f39038532ae2b5f049c5720cfd52717accf41ec7023f9
spent
true